1. When is the service interval reset required?

On-board computer ŠKODA Rapid counts down the mileage or days until the next maintenance based on factory parameters. A signal about the need for a reset appears in three cases:

  • 🔧 After scheduled maintenance (changing oil, filters, etc.). Even if the work was not performed in an official service center, a reset is required.
  • ⚠️ When false operation of the maintenance indicator (for example, after replacing the battery or resetting errors by the scanner).
  • 🔄 When switching to another type of oil (for example, with LongLife on Fixed), which requires interval adjustment.
  • 🚗 After buying a used car, unless the previous owner reset the indicator.

Ignoring the reset is not critical for the car, but it leads to a constant lighting of the maintenance light on the dashboard and possible problems during diagnostics at the service center. On display Maxi-DOT or Virtual Cockpit a message may be displayed "Service in XX days" or "Oil change" is a direct signal to action.

2. The official reset method is through the on-board computer menu

The safest and manufacturer-recommended method is to use the built-in menu. Suitable for all versions Rapid 2018, including restyled models. The instructions are relevant for dashboards Maxi-DOT and Virtual Cockpit:

  1. Turn on the ignition (position ON, do not start the engine).
  2. Press and hold the button 0.0/SET (or OK on the steering wheel) until the menu appears.
  3. Using buttons ▲/▼ select the section on the steering column switch "Service" or "Inspection".
  4. Hold 0.0/SET (or OK) 5-10 seconds until the reset confirmation appears.
  5. The display will show "Service reset?" — Confirm your choice by pressing again.

After a successful reset, the message will appear on the screen "Service in 365 days" or similar (depending on the type of oil). If the menu does not open, check:

  • 🔋 Battery charge level (voltage must be at least 12.3 V).
  • 🚗 Correct selection of ignition mode (not ACC, namely ON).
  • 🔧 There are no errors in the system (check with a scanner or via Menu → Vehicle status).

3. Alternative reset methods (no menu)

If the standard method does not work, use one of the alternative methods. They are suitable for cases where the on-board computer menu is inaccessible or blocked.

Method 1: Through a combination of buttons

This method works on most Rapid with Maxi-DOT:

  1. Turn off the ignition.
  2. Press and hold the button 0.0/SET (or OK on the steering wheel).
  3. Without releasing the button, turn on the ignition (position ON).
  4. Hold the button for another 10-15 seconds until the reset menu appears.

Method 2: Via diagnostic connector (VCDS/OBD2)

If software methods do not help, you will need a diagnostic scanner (VCDS, OBDeleven, Carista). Instructions:

  1. Connect the scanner to the connector OBD2 (located under the steering wheel on the left).
  2. Select block "17 – Instruments" (dashboard).
  3. Go to section "Adaptation" or "Service Reset".
  4. Select channel "IDE03246" (for MQB) and set the value "0".
  5. Save the changes and restart the on-board computer (turn off/on the ignition).

Important: On diesel versions, after resetting via VCDS, additional calibration of the diesel particulate filter (DPF) may be required. Use channel IDE04141 with parameter "1" to start the procedure.

4. Maintenance reset on diesel versions (1.6 TDI)

Diesel ŠKODA Rapid with engine 1.6 TDI (codes CRTD, CJXB) have additional nuances due to the system AdBlue and particulate filter (DPF). A standard menu reset may not work if:

  • 🚨 There are active errors in the system DPF (for example, P2458 - low level of reagent).
  • ⚠️ Level AdBlue below 20% (topping up required).
  • 🔧 The previous reset was performed incorrectly (for example, through an uncertified scanner).

For diesel versions, the following algorithm is recommended:

  1. Check the level AdBlue (must be at least 80%). Add only original reagent VW G 052 910 A2.
  2. Eliminate errors by DPF (if necessary, perform forced regeneration via VCDS).
  3. Perform a maintenance reset via the menu or VCDS (block "17 – Instruments", channel IDE03246).
  4. Reset the mileage counter until the next service in the block "01 – Engine" (channel IDE00820).

5. Frequent errors and their elimination

Even when following the instructions, owners ŠKODA Rapid are facing problems. Let's look at typical situations and solutions:

Problem Possible reason Solution
Reset menu does not open Low battery voltage Charge the battery or connect the battery charger
After reset, scheduled maintenance indicator lights up continuously Errors in the block "01 – Engine" Check with a scanner and troubleshoot
On Virtual Cockpit there is no "Service" item Software update required Contact the service for flashing the dashboard
Reset via VCDS is not saved Blocked due to errors DPF/AdBlue Correct the errors, then try the reset again

If none of the methods help, the reason may be:

  • 🔌 Wiring problems (for example, oxidation of contacts in the dashboard connector).
  • 🖥️ Firmware failure on-board computer (requires flashing via ODIS).
  • 🔑 Non-original ignition key (some duplicates block access to service functions).
What should I do if the “Workshop!” error appears after the reset?

This error indicates the need to visit the service and often occurs when the reset is performed incorrectly through the scanner. Solution:

1. Connect VCDS and go to the block "17 – Instruments".

2. In section "Adaptation" find a channel IDE03246 and set the value "255".

3. Save the changes and restart the on-board computer.

If the error remains, diagnostics are required at an official service center - the dashboard EEPROM may be damaged.

6. How can I check if the reset was successful?

After completing the procedure, you need to make sure that the reset was completed correctly. To do this:

  1. Turn on the ignition and check the display Maxi-DOT or Virtual Cockpit. Inscription "Service in XX days" should update to "365 days" (or another interval, depending on the type of oil).
  2. Start the engine and let it run for 1-2 minutes. Make sure that the maintenance indicator (wrench or inscription "OIL") went out.
  3. Check for errors through the on-board computer menu: Menu → Vehicle status → Check.

On vehicles with Virtual Cockpit Additional information can be obtained by clicking the button VIEW on the steering wheel and selecting the section "Service". It displays:

  • 📅 Next maintenance date.
  • 📏 Remaining mileage before service.
  • ⚙️ Oil type (LongLife or Fixed).

7. Features for different types of oils

ŠKODA Rapid 2018 supports two service modes:

  • 🛢️ Fixed (fixed interval) - oil change every 15,000 km or 1 year.
  • 🕒 LongLife (flexible interval) - up to 30,000 km or 2 years (depending on operating conditions).

The type of oil affects the reset algorithm:

Oil type Reset channel (VCDS) Value after reset Notes
Fixed IDE03246 0 Standard interval 15,000 km
LongLife IDE03246 1 Interval up to 30,000 km, but may be reduced
LongLife (diesel) IDE03246 + IDE04141 1 + 1 Reset required DPF and AdBlue

To change the oil type (for example, from Fixed on LongLife), follow these steps:

  1. Connect VCDS and go to the block "17 – Instruments".
  2. In the section "Adaptation" find a channel IDE00820.
  3. Set value "1" for LongLife or "0" for Fixed.
  4. Save the changes and perform a maintenance reset again.

Note: Go to LongLife only possible when using oil VW 504 00/507 00 and compliance with operating conditions (for example, no short trips in the cold season).

FAQ: Frequently asked questions about resetting maintenance on the ŠKODA Rapid 2018

❓ Is it possible to reset the MOT without a scanner if the menu does not work?

Yes, on most versions with Maxi-DOT a combination of buttons helps: hold 0.0/SET when the ignition is turned on. If this doesn't work, check the battery voltage (should be at least 12.3 V) or try disconnecting the negative terminal for 10 minutes (but this may reset other settings, such as the radio).

❓ Why does scheduled maintenance indicator light up red after a reset via VCDS?

The red indicator color indicates critical failure, not related to maintenance. Most often these are errors in DPF (on diesel) or oil pressure sensor. Connect the scanner, check the blocks "01 – Engine" and "25 – Immobilizer", clear the errors, then try the reset again.

❓ How to reset maintenance on Rapid with Virtual Cockpit?

On a digital dashboard, the algorithm is similar, but control is carried out through touch buttons on the steering wheel or a joystick. Path: Menu → Vehicle → Service → Reset. If item "Reset" no, the panel software needs to be updated (contact service).

❓ What happens if you don’t reset the maintenance after changing the oil?

Nothing critical will happen - the car will drive normally. However:

  • The maintenance indicator on the instrument panel will be constantly lit.
  • During diagnostics, the service may display an error "Service overdue".
  • On diesel versions with AdBlue it is possible to block the engine starting 1000 km after the expiration date.
❓ Is it possible to reset the maintenance via the application on the phone (ELM327)?

Yes, but with reservations. Applications like Carista or OBDeleven support maintenance reset to ŠKODA Rapid, but:

  • Required original ELM327 (not a cheap fake).
  • On diesel versions it may not work due to blocking DPF/AdBlue.
  • Some features are paid (for example, in Carista resetting the maintenance costs ~10€).

Algorithm: connect the adapter, select ŠKODA Rapid → Service Reset → Oil Inspection.
